Output ecd15805fd84cdb680c5a88c7a1fc5d656c6357646009087407730334d0f7a8f:1

value
19576392
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3156d6e72df667b25cab75556f9beaf47852d6f1 OP_EQUAL
address
MCQ3NYNV98Epy4fopG2yPxAf1KaC9hqXrx
transaction
ecd15805fd84cdb680c5a88c7a1fc5d656c6357646009087407730334d0f7a8f
spent
true